Alert: SLIM-IMG-DRIFT

This alert fires when a container image produced by the Parelight slimming pipeline exceeds its size budget by more than 15% compared to the previous release candidate. Common causes include disabled layer deduplication or a new base image. Builds exceeding budget are blocked from promotion until acknowledged. Review the slimming report attached to the build, then confirm or waive before the release cutoff. For waivers, contact the pipeline owners.

escalation mailbox, bafog-fafog: ulador@paliqlabs.internal

Subject: DR drill — Gridwhistle crossword generator

Team: DR drill runs Thursday 09:00. We'll fail over the Gridwhistle puzzle-generation cluster to the standby region and verify daily crosswords still publish. Expect ~10 min of degraded clue rendering. Don't open incident tickets during the window. If the standby console prompts you during verification, enter the drill recovery passphrase shown on the next line.

unlock words, hahip-baduf: holwyn-istath-julvan

Warranty expense for the Clarenwood range exceeded plan by 18% this quarter, driven chiefly by compressor replacements on the HX-Frost line. Provisioning assumptions set last spring underestimated claim frequency in humid regions, and repair labour rates rose faster than forecast. Branch managers should review local claims handling for consistency and flag repeat-failure units weekly. A revised reserve model takes effect next month. The confidential note below outlines related business plans.

management briefing: Project Ulavan slips by two quarters because of the staffing delay.

- [ ] **Step 7 — Autocomplete Index Custodian Handoff.** During the Lintervale key ceremony, the contractor restores the QuickSuggest autocomplete index signing key. Note the index rebuild is slow (roughly forty minutes), so begin the restore before verifying shard checksums. Confirm both witnesses are present, then unlock the custodian terminal. When the terminal asks for the custodian phrase, type the recovery passphrase given directly below.

recovery phrase for fajeg-hagug: holox-fenmir